linux关闭端口防火墙命令行
-
在Linux系统中,关闭端口的防火墙有多种命令行方式。下面列举了两种常用的方法:
方法一:使用iptables命令关闭端口防火墙
1. 登录到Linux系统的终端(命令行界面)。
2. 使用root用户或具有sudo权限的用户身份执行以下命令:“`
sudo iptables -A INPUT -p tcp –dport <端口号> -j DROP
“`其中,<端口号>是要关闭的端口号,例如80代表关闭HTTP的端口。
3. 执行完上述命令后,关闭的端口将无法访问。如果需要关闭多个端口,可以多次执行以上命令。
方法二:使用firewalld命令关闭端口防火墙
1. 登录到Linux系统的终端。
2. 使用root用户或具有sudo权限的用户身份执行以下命令:“`
sudo firewall-cmd –zone=public –remove-port=<端口号>/tcp –permanent
sudo firewall-cmd –reload
“`其中,<端口号>是要关闭的端口号。
3. 执行完上述命令后,关闭的端口将无法访问。如果需要关闭多个端口,可以多次执行以上命令。
请注意,以上方法都需要以root用户或具有sudo权限的用户身份运行命令。另外,修改防火墙规则可能会影响系统的安全性,请谨慎操作。如果不确定如何操作,建议咨询系统管理员或相关专业人士的指导。
2年前 -
要关闭Linux上的端口防火墙,可以使用以下命令行:
1. 查看防火墙状态:使用命令“`sudo ufw status“`查看当前防火墙状态,确认是否已启用防火墙。
2. 关闭防火墙:使用命令“`sudo ufw disable“`关闭防火墙。根据提示,确认是否要执行此操作。
3. 开启指定端口:如果只想关闭某个特定的端口,可以使用“`sudo ufw deny <端口号>“`命令。例如,“`sudo ufw deny 22“`表示关闭SSH端口。
4. 允许指定端口:如果想关闭除了某个特定端口外的所有端口,可以先关闭所有端口,然后再允许指定端口。步骤如下:
– 关闭所有端口:“`sudo ufw default deny“`命令会将所有端口列为禁止状态。
– 允许指定端口:“`sudo ufw allow <端口号>“`命令可以允许指定端口。例如,“`sudo ufw allow 80“`表示允许HTTP端口。5. 重新启用防火墙:如果想重新启用防火墙,可以使用“`sudo ufw enable“`命令启用防火墙。
请注意,使用以上命令需要具有root或sudo权限。关闭防火墙可能会降低系统的安全性,请谨慎操作,并在确保不需要端口开放的情况下进行关闭。
2年前 -
在Linux中,要关闭端口防火墙(Firewall),可以使用iptables命令行工具。Iptables是Linux上一个处理包过滤规则的工具,可以用于配置、管理和维护网络协议数据包过滤规则。
以下是关闭端口防火墙的方法和操作流程:
1. 确认iptables是否已经安装:
输入命令`iptables –version`,如果没有报错信息,说明iptables已经安装。2. 查看当前的防火墙规则:
输入命令`iptables -L`,这将显示当前的iptables规则。如果防火墙开启,可以看到相应的规则信息。3. 关闭端口:
输入命令`iptables -A INPUT -p tcp –dport 端口号 -j DROP`,将端口号替换为需要关闭的端口。例如,如果要关闭80端口,输入命令`iptables -A INPUT -p tcp –dport 80 -j DROP`。
4. 保存并重启iptables:
输入命令`/etc/init.d/iptables save`,这将保存当前iptables配置。输入命令`/etc/init.d/iptables restart`,这将重新加载iptables配置并重启iptables服务。
5. 确认端口是否已关闭:
输入命令`iptables -L`,再次查看iptables规则,确认端口是否已成功关闭。这样,你就成功关闭了指定端口的防火墙。
需要注意的是,关闭端口防火墙可能会导致网络安全问题,因此在关闭端口之前,请确保你已经评估了风险,并且只关闭了确实不需要开放的端口。
2年前